Hi Melsoon,
Do you want to only change the arrays a and b to 1D array or change all arrays to 1D array?
If you only request the former, you can write array a and b to 1D in sequence. And acquire northWall or eastWall as below:
northWall[15][0] = a[15*16+0];
eastWall[15][0] = b[15*16+0];

To make 'a' a 1D array you can do this:
int[] array = a.SelectMany(item => item).ToArray();

I wrote a function for you and tried to comment it as good as I could:
public int[] Int2DTo1D(int[][] Int2DArray) { if(Int2DArray != null) { // Variable for containing the total amount of integer values found within the array. int TotalArrayLength = 0; for (int i = 0; i < Int2DArray.Length; i++) { // Loop through all sub arrays to get the total amount of integer values. if (Int2DArray[i] != null) { // Prevent the runtime error when calling the length of a null array. // Add the array length to the array length counter. TotalArrayLength += Int2DArray[i].Length; } } if (TotalArrayLength == 0) { // There is no values within the array. return null; } // Create a 1d array buffer to put all the arrays into. int[] Int1DArray = new int[TotalArrayLength]; // Value for storing our current array position. int Position = 0; for (int i = 0; i < Int2DArray.Length; i++) { // Loop through all sub arrays again to add them to the 1d array buffer. if (Int2DArray[i] != null) { // Prevent the runtime error when calling the length of a null array. for (int x = 0; x < Int2DArray[i].Length; x++) { // Inserting the value into the 1d array buffer. Int1DArray[Position] = Int2DArray[i][x]; // Updating the position to insert the next int value. Position++; } } } // Now we are done and ready to return the 1d array. return Int1DArray; } else { // Array is empty. return null; } }
